Transaction 16d69ceff70f97def9e187b9a32d579928be772533f8ea1df33b72035205286a

1 Input
2 Outputs
  • 16d69ceff70f97def9e187b9a32d579928be772533f8ea1df33b72035205286a:0
  • value  648897
    address  17SQkUHgEbn6G9b7A6rnBHgZ9ZpCrcGSWa
  • 16d69ceff70f97def9e187b9a32d579928be772533f8ea1df33b72035205286a:1
  • value  153608964
    address  3QTaAZzThshkRm6AFiRCR6jUSyH6TQeMZt